Spotting a False Analogy

What is Spotting a False Analogy?

Six questions for catching a bad analogy. (1) What conclusion is the analogy meant to establish? (2) Does the resemblance actually bear on that conclusion? (3) Is one shared feature being treated as making the whole thing alike? (4) What key differences might change the outcome? (5) Could the similar outcome have another cause entirely? (6) Is the analogy still a prompt for thinking, or has it quietly become the proof? Watch for the giveaway phrases: “everyone else does it this way”, “it has always worked”, “you do it too”.

Spotting a False Analogy: common mistakes and how to handle them

Typical bad analogies: comparing a question about a course to disloyalty to one’s own family moves the subject rather than answering it; “the school next door doesn’t even offer art” uses someone else’s shortcoming to dodge your own; “schools that added a logic course still have discipline problems” proves nothing from a single case; “a coroner is rigorous, so they will make a fine general manager” over-extends the analogy, and “a coroner’s experience is worth nothing here” is equally wrong — the transferable habits of thought have to be separated from the domain knowledge that isn’t transferable. “The kid down the road does two workbooks and does well, so you will too”: same age and same year are surface resemblances, while prior knowledge, the weak subjects, and sleep are what actually bear on the result — extract the mechanism behind the method and trial it against your own case. A useful reply: “these two situations really are alike in some ways; let’s also check three differences.”

What the Spotting a False Analogy questions test

judging which of the six questions an analogy fails; separating a surface resemblance from a relevant one; spotting an analogy used for emotional leverage, or one that dodges the issue by pointing at someone else’s flaw; converting “copy what they did” into “extract the mechanism and test it”.
